			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>One of the most popular ways to either settle or litigate any <a href="http://auto-accident-settlements.net/auto-accident-insurance-claim/">auto accident insurance claim</a> is through the use of a lawyer that offers you his services on the basis of no win no fee.  This is also known as a conditional fee agreement.  This is a great way to litigate your claims because it lets you hire a quality lawyer and puts you on even footing with the insurance company without having to spend any money out of your pocket initially.  However, these lawyers still come with a price, so make sure that you still do your research beforehand so that you can keep a larger chunk of your settlement.<span id="more-237"></span></p>
<h3>Research Your Lawyer</h3>
<p>Just like with any other attorney, whether it is a personal injury or <a href="http://auto-accident-settlements.net/whiplash-lawyer/">whiplash lawyer</a>, make sure that you do your research on the lawyer you plan on hiring before you file your claim.  Once you’re getting ready to file your claim and have decided to use a lawyer, ask around among people you know such as your friends and family and see if they have any recommendations for a good lawyer.  If not, the internet is also a good source for recommendations and information as well as the local yellow pages.  Try to find out as much as you can about each lawyer beforehand so that you can ask informed questions during the next step.</p>
<h3>Meet Your Accident Claims No Win No Fee Lawyer</h3>
<p>The next thing that you will need to do is meet the lawyer that is going to be handling your <a href="http://auto-accident-settlements.net">auto accident settlement</a>.  By this time, out of the recommendations that your friends and family have made and recommendations that you have read on the internet and in other places, you should have trimmed them down to just a few lawyers that you are going to meet with.  It’s important that you do at least a small amount of background research on these lawyers and your case so that you can ask them about their services and how they will try your case to get the most amount of money from it.</p>
<p>Ask your potential lawyer every question that you can possibly think of, from how likely it is that he thinks it can be settled to when you will be getting your money.  This is the time when you should also make sure that you are very clear on the fees that the lawyer plans on charging.  Fees for no win no fee accident claims can vary from ten percent to twenty five percent of the total amount of your claim.</p>
<p>This isn’t to say that you should always take the lawyer with the lowest fees however.   Many times you will end up getting what you pay for and a better lawyer will cost you a little bit more money.  But, only look at this as a few percentage points, otherwise the fee will be greater than the amount that the lawyer can actually win you extra with his experience.  Carefully weigh all your choices.</p>
<h3>Sign the Conditional Fee Agreement</h3>
<p>After you have decided on which lawyer that you want, the final step for you to take is to sign the conditional fee agreement that will establish the lawyer that you want as your no win no fee lawyer.  This will be binding and usually greatly limit your options to seek legal help elsewhere, so make sure that you think long and hard before you sign this agreement and you know all of the terms and conditions involved in it.</p>
<p>Finding a no win no fee lawyer for your auto accident claim can be easy, however finding the best one that gives you the most value for your money can be a little bit harder.  But, if you take the time to do it, you’ll end up with a  bigger settlement that will go a much further way to compensating you for the injuries that you suffered.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>A hit and run accident is one of the most common problems experienced on the road today, and this is usually a result of actions and events that you have been easily avoided with a bit of awareness. Because many people insist on driving while speaking on the cellular phone or eating, they are not able to determine distances of other cars on the road. This trouble with perception can often lead to a hit and run car accident. This occurs when one vehicle crashed into another and the offending driver speeds off in order to avoid responsibility. This is usually because the crash could have been a result of a <a href="http://auto-accident-settlements.net/dui-accident/">dui accident</a> or the driver simply does not want to pay for any damaged caused by the crash. If you ever experience hit and run car accidents then you are well aware that the driver often is able to escape easily without being held responsible for the damage caused.<span id="more-232"></span></p>
<p>You should be aware of what to do in the event that a similar accident ever happens in your presence. The first thing that should be done is to bring the car to a total stop and use any available camera to take pictures of any damaged. Both vehicles should be photographed in detail and this will help to prevent any accusations that damages have been added after the accident. Storing a disposable camera in the glove compartment is a great idea that any driver will benefit from. This is useful because the pictures will include a date stamp that can be used to verify the validity of any damage claim. These are more useful than cellular phone cameras because the photos are higher quality and this allows the smallest detail to show up. This is important when providing damage because they may need to show such problems as a scratched paint job and a high quality camera will be needed for this. These cameras are inexpensive to buy and they can be thrown away when fully used. They typically store 24 pictures and this is enough to photograph each vehicle in detail.</p>
<p><a href="http://auto-accident-settlements.net/wp-content/uploads/2010/07/that-hurt.jpg"><img class="alignright size-full wp-image-233" title="that hurt" src="http://auto-accident-settlements.net/wp-content/uploads/2010/07/that-hurt.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="216" /></a>Another important thing that should be done is to examine the scene for anyone that could be a potential witness to the accident. Asking these people for a statement would be very helpful. However, this is something that you could simply allow the cops to conduct after writing down the name and phone number and anyone that may have any perspective to offer on the accident.</p>
<p>Since the other driver is already gone, you can&#8217;t exactly exchange information as you normally would.  Try to ask any present witness if they could provide the license plate number. If this is not possible then you should contact the police about this accident right away and inform them that driver has fled the scene of an accident.  Sit tight and wait for the police to show up so that they can verify the accident happened.</p>
<p>Hit and run accident penalties are severe and can lead to jail time if the driver is located. In many states, this is considered a Felony and extensive amounts of incarcerations have resulted from cases of this type. Leaving an accident is a very serious crime and contacting the police is the best option available to a victim. If the driver is located then he may face extended time in jail in addition to being held liable for any damaged resulting from the accident in the resulting <a href="http://auto-accident-settlements.net">auto accident settlement</a>.</p>
<p>If you&#8217;ve been in an hit and run and the driver is never found, in most cases your insurance should be able to cover your damages in an <a href="http://auto-accident-settlements.net/auto-accident-insurance-claim/">auto accident insurance claim</a>.  However, you will need to take steps to make sure that this will happen.  Take pictures, try to find any witnesses that you can, and call the police to verify the accident happened.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>For people that have never been in an auto accident before, and sometimes even for those that have, filing an auto accident insurance claim is a tricky, stressful experience.  There are a multitude of things that can go wrong that will result in you not getting a settlement big enough to compensate you for your injuries.  If you want to avoid this and have your insurance claim go off without a hitch follow these simple and easy tips.  If these tips aren’t enough to get your claim filed easily, make sure to seek some legal help to make sure you get the money you deserve.<span id="more-173"></span></p>
<h3>Contact Your Insurance Company Immediately</h3>
<p>Immediately after your accident, make sure that you contact your insurance company.  Most insurance companies have a toll-free 1-800 number that can be called at any time of the day or night.  These companies also sometime dispatch vehicles to your crash scene to make sure that you get all the information taken down and have the help that you need after the crash.</p>
<p>If your insurance company doesn’t have a number to call, at least make sure to call your insurance agent as soon as possible.  Inform them that you have been in a wreck and tell them your side of the story honestly and frankly.</p>
<h3>Take Pictures and Keep Records</h3>
<p><a href="http://auto-accident-settlements.net/wp-content/uploads/2010/03/car-crash.jpg"><img class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-174" title="car crash" src="http://auto-accident-settlements.net/wp-content/uploads/2010/03/car-crash-300x199.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="199" /></a>Either soon after or just before you call the insurance company, if it’s possible take pictures of the accident scene.  After the accident, make sure that you keep all the paperwork that pertains to the accident.  This includes any police reports, hospital records, rental car receipts, or anything else that might be compensated by your insurance company.  Too much information is always better than not having the one right piece that you need and facing a reduced settlement because of it.</p>
<h3>Visit the Hospital if You Are Injured</h3>
<p>If you think that you might be injured in the accident, make sure that you visit the hospital as soon after the accident as possible.  As with all the other paperwork you receive that relates to the crash, make sure that you keep a copy of it for your records as well as what doctors you saw.  Always follow all of your doctor’s advice and make sure that you aren’t violating any of your doctor’s orders.  If you’re healthy enough to stop your treatment or to play in the company softball game, it casts doubt on whether you were really injured in the first place.</p>
<h3>Know the Ins and Outs of Your Insurance Policy</h3>
<p>Make sure that you make yourself intimately familiar with your insurance policy soon after the wreck.  Know what’s included in your coverage and what’s not and what you are legally entitled to.  Remember , you’re paying the insurance company for this coverage, so they’re legally required to compensate you for everything that’s listed in your policy when you file your auto accident insurance claim.</p>
<h3>Tell the Truth and Be Honest</h3>
<p>Finally, when you’re filing your claim, make sure that you tell the truth and are honest.  Resist the urge to play up your injuries or make things appear worse than they already are.  If you treat insurance adjusters with a level of respect, odds are they will treat you with respect as well and if they don’t suspect you to be lying they most likely won’t go over every detail of your case with a fine toothed comb.  It will ensure that all your auto accident settlement negotiations go more smoothly.</p>
<p>However, you can always hire a lawyer as a recourse to make sure that your rights are protected if you do end up getting an insurance agent that is difficult to deal with or won’t compensate you for the injuries and property damage you sustained.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Whiplash is by far the most common injury sustained in automobile accidents.  Over one million people a hurt by whiplash each year.  Whiplash injuries range from neck soreness to an incredibly painful injury that requires months of physical therapy to repair.  Over thirty billion dollars will be spent to treat these injuries each year as well.  Since so many auto accident settlement amounts involve some damage due to whiplash injuries, it’s important to know when you should seek a settlement for whiplash.</p>
<p>Whiplash is trauma that is suffered to the head, neck, and spine because of a violent snapping back and forward of the neck.  They occur most often in rear end collisions when one car is at rest and gets knocked into by another car.  If a driver uses improper <a href="http://carseatforyou.blogspot.com/2009/12/seat-related-problems-and-support.html" target="_blank">car seat support</a>, this causes the head to jerk back and forward, much like the end of a bullwhip, and giving the injury its name.  Whiplash happens in almost every wreck like this, but is more severe in some cases than in others.  In general, you should seek a whiplash settlement if you have to seek treatment for the injuries and incur any kind of medical costs.  If you don’t seek treatment for your injuries, it will be difficult to prove in court that you actually sustained one, so if you do think you may have gotten some form of whiplash, make sure to visit a doctor or hospital.</p>
<p>If you do seek treatment, you can choose to settle with the insurance company yourself or hire a lawyer to negotiate with them on your behalf.  If your injuries are minor it may save you money to negotiate yourself, but if your <strong>whiplash settlement</strong> involves large amounts of injury, you should more often than not hire an attorney.  An attorney has experience in working with insurance companies and will be able to tell you accurately how much you case should be settled for and which cases should be taken to court.</p>
<p>Any settlement for whiplash should include all medical bill incurred as a result of the car accident, damages sustained to your car and property, any rental car expenses, and all time missed from work as a direct result of the accident.  The settlement may also involve an amount known as pain and suffering, which compensates you for the harm to your emotional state the injury caused as well as other intangibles of enjoying life that the accident made you miss out on.  This amount can be accurately determined by attorneys from prior experience, but in a jam, you can usually set it at three times the total of the other expenses.</p>
<p>When applying for a car accident settlement that involves whiplash make sure that you know the agreement inside and out.  Sometimes the contract that you sign with the company can involve stipulations that aren’t in your favor, such that the insurance company will pay you in installments instead of in one lump sum.  Also be aware that you are subject to a statute of limitation to when you can pursue your whiplash case, this varies in time from state to state.  Past this time you can’t bring an insurance company to court over the accident.</p>
<p>Whiplash is one of the most common forms of injuries that is sustained in auto accidents.  If you are forced to seek medical care because of someone else’s negligence, you are entitled to and deserve to be compensated for the time they cost your and the property they destroyed.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Finding out the right <strong>car accident compensation</strong> varies from case to case.  In some cases that only involve property damage or minor medical damages, the amount you will accept is fairly straightforward.  But in larger cases, where there may be serious injury involved and a significant amount of pain and suffering damages can be sought, the amount of damages you can seek is not as clear.</p>
<h3>Determining Car Accident Compensation in Simple Cases</h3>
<p>If you are involved in a minor car crash, determining the compensation that you are entitled to is fairly straightforward.  Your biggest worry is to make sure that you keep all your receipts and proof of damages.  Since these cases are simpler, there will also be very little, if any, negotiations with the <a title="An insurance agency bring the public many services | Everything from Private Health Insurance to Life Insurance leads and General Finance." href="http://thelivingbusiness.com/2009/10/an-insurance-agency-bring-the-public-many-services/" target="_blank">Auto Insurance Agency</a> during a <a href="http://auto-accident-settlements.net">settlement</a>.</p>
<p>If you have sustained an injury, such as whiplash, make sure that you seek medical care right away and complete all treatments that are prescribed for you.  Keep track of all of your medical bills during this time, including visits to chiropractors, doctors, and the emergency room.  The damage sustained to your car can be fixed at a repair shop of your choice.  This seems like it’s the insurance companies being generous, but it is more because if the repairs are subpar and you end up having to repair your car again later, the insurance company can say you chose the mechanic so they are not liable for any further damages.  For this reason, if the insurance company that you are dealing with has certified dealers that guarantee their repairs you should take your car there to make sure it gets repaired right.  Also keep track of any transportation costs you incurred as a direct result of the crash, including rental cars or having to use a <a href="http://carfinderphilippines.net/" target="_blank">car finder</a> service to get a new car.</p>
<h3>Determining Compensation in Serious Accidents</h3>
<p>If you’ve had a serious car accident that involves either complex property damage or significant <a href="http://auto-accident-settlements.net/auto-accident-injury-settlements/">bodily injury</a>, it would be advisable to hire an attorney.  In these <a href="http://auto-accident-settlements.net/auto-accident-claims/">auto accident claims</a>, there is also significant pain and suffering damages involved.  Pain and suffering can be a hard number to arrive at because it depends on a variety of factors such as age, severity of injuries, and your future prognosis.  It can be hard to get the full amount that you deserve in cases like this without the use of a lawyer.</p>
<p>In addition to being able to more accurately gauge the amount that you are owed, lawyers also have more experience in negotiating auto accident settlements.  This experience is much needed in complex cases where pain and suffering damages can be very flexible and it takes a lawyer who knows how different factors will affect what a jury, and thus the insurance company is likely to award you.</p>
<p><img style="float: left;" src="http://auto-accident-settlements.net/wp-content/uploads/2009/10/minor-accident-300x225.jpg" alt="Minor Accident" width="300" height="225" />How difficult it is to find the right car accident compensation for you is determined by how complex and severe your case is.  If you have a simple case just involving property damage, you should be able to talk to insurance companies on your own.  But if you case involves significant bodily injury or pain and suffering damage, you should consider hiring a lawyer to protect your rights.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>There are over five million auto accidents every year that result in two million injured people and close to twenty thousand dead.  If you are unfortunate enough to be adversely affected by an auto accident, one of the options you have to resolve your claim is to pursue an <strong>auto accident settlement</strong>.  However, attempting to negotiate with an insurance company can be extremely hard, frustrating, and confusing all at the same time.  Fortunately, there are several different things that you can do to increase your chances of a settlement in your favor.  Unfortunately, like most things this will take some time, effort, and research on your part.</p>
<h3>Attorney or No Attorney?</h3>
<p>The first major decision that you will have to make when dealing with car accident claims is whether or not to hire an attorney to work on your behalf.  This will many times depend on the size of your case and the cost of the lawyer.  If your case is complicated or involves a large settlement amount, it will most likely be worth your money to hire an attorney to litigate the case and negotiate with the insurance company on your behalf.  However, if your case is fairly straightforward and easy to understand or involves a fairly small settlement amount, it may not be worth the money to hire an attorney.  Whatever you can in the settlement from having the attorney negotiate for you will most likely be offset by the attorney’s fees.</p>
<p>There are several things that an attorney will do for you during an auto accident injury settlement.  They will take care of gathering all the necessary information and submitting it to the insurance company.  They can also more accurately determine the amount of pain and suffering damages you can ask for and also are aware of all the rules that are designed to protect your rights in the case.  Attorneys may also know several people in the insurance company you’re dealing with, increasing the odds of a settlement in your favor.  Finally, and most importantly, attorneys have lots of experience with insurance negotiations.  This experience will let them negotiate harder and will ensure that you will mostly likely get more money in any settlement than you would if you negotiated for yourself.</p>
<p>You will have to weigh the pros and cons of hiring a lawyer on a case by case basis.</p>
<h3>Filing an Auto Accident Insurance Claim</h3>
<p><img class="alignright size-medium wp-image-36" title="blurry" src="http://auto-accident-settlements.net/wp-content/uploads/2009/10/blurry-300x225.jpg" alt="blurry" width="300" height="225" />Before you get to the settlement phase of any negotiation, you must first file an insurance claim after the auto accident.  What you do in this step and how thorough you are with the information you collect will directly affect how much money you will be able to receive in any settlement.</p>
<p>First, immediately after a crash make sure you take pictures of the accident and the surrounding area.  Make sure you keep these backed up and private as an ace up your sleeve to use in any negotiations with the insurance company.  Also get a copy of the police report and any tickets that assign blame for the crash.  Finally, think you may be injured in any way make sure you visit the emergency room.  Whether or not you seek care from a professional is how insurance companies determine if you were injured or not.  If you do not seek care immediately they can make a case that the injury was caused by something other than the car crash.</p>
<p>If you need continuing treatment for any injuries sustained in the crash make sure that you keep copies of all of your medical records.  Also keep records of any lost wages from work and time and money spent traveling to and from the treatment facility.  All of this documentation will come in handy during negotiations.</p>
<p>If your car was damaged in the crash, make sure you take it to a body shop that you trust and that you keep all records of what was repaired.  Some insurance companies have certified body shops that you can take your car to so that in the event the repaired part fails you are covered.  If you decide to go to a different body shop, it would be wise to have a second shop double check your car to make sure it is repaired correctly.</p>
<h3>Negotiating Auto Accident Settlements</h3>
<p><img class="alignleft" title="car accident" src="http://auto-accident-settlements.net/wp-content/uploads/2009/10/car-accident-300x199.jpg" alt="car accident" width="300" height="199" />If you have done the steps above and kept thorough records of everything dealing with your crash, you will be in a much better position to negotiate your settlement with the insurance company.  Remember that an insurance settlement is really a negotiation between you and the insurance company.  You and the insurance company are essentially deciding on the price that it will take to keep you from taking your case to court.  The negotiation strategies that are used in business, politics, and other arenas will work here, so if you are an experienced negotiator, you will have an advantages over other when it comes to this stage.</p>
<p>The first thing you should do before heading over to meet with the insurance company is to determine a range that you think is acceptable to you to settle the claim.  This is your “win set”.  The insurance company will have made one of these up as well, and it will undoubtedly be lower than yours.  In general, your goal should be to move the insurance adjuster’s win set so that it is inside yours and you get the greatest possible settlement.  The insurance adjuster will be trying to do this as well, but to get your to agree to the least possible settlement.  There are various tactics you can both use.</p>
<p>Remember in automobile accident settlements you are selling to the insurance company your rights to take them to court over the auto accident you suffered.  Any information that you can present that would strengthen your case in the eyes of a jury and cause them to reward you more money will strengthen your bargaining position and usually cause the adjuster to bump up his price.  This can include photos of your crushed car, evidence that the other party was under the influence, and other factors.  Having all your paperwork in order also strengthens you position because there are less holes that the insurance company can poke into your argument over technicalities.  When negotiating, always have the insurance company make the first Finally, hiring a lawyer also strengthens your position.  Not only is the lawyer more experience at negotiations, hiring a lawyer also sends a message that you are not afraid of taking the case to trial if the settlement offered by the insurance company is not adequate.</p>
<p>The insurance company will also have several tricks that they will use to make your car accident compensation lower.  The first is the long amount of time you must usually wait to receive any money.  This is not always the case, but companies are aware that most people will need the money from their settlement to pay off medical bills and make up for lost wages.  By making you jump through more hoops during the settlement process and delaying their actions, they make you more and more desperate for money and more likely to accept any settlement they offer.  They will also attempt to cast any doubt they can on your claims if you do not have the adequate paperwork.  This is why it is very important to collect the right paperwork during all the different phases of your accident and settlement.</p>
